TYRONE, Pa. -Â The Duquesne University women's cross country team had the top-five finishers and took home the team title at the Red Flash Rally this past Sunday afternoon.
Mara Whalen won the four-kilometer race after crossing the finish line at 15 minutes, 51.5 seconds.
Angela Valotta placed second with a time of 16 minutes, 3.8 seconds, while Sophia Trevenen claimed third place with a time of 16 minutes, 34.9 seconds.
Kierra Shreffler and
Delaney Line rounded out the top-five. Shreffler took fourth overall after finishing in 16 minutes, 50 seconds, while Line was fifth overall with a time of 17 minutes, 6.8 seconds.
Duquesne will look to finish the season strong when they compete at the NCAA Mid-Atlantic Regional Championships hosted by Penn State in State College, Pennsylvania on Friday, Nov. 11 at 10:30 a.m.
